UGUI中,Button使用enable=false和interactable=false都可以禁用按钮,区别是enable取消Button组件,而interactable取消Button组件的Interactable,让按钮颜色变为Disabled Color。
GameObject carderButtonButton = UIManager.Instance.GetGameObject(“”XXX“”); carderButtonButton.GetComponent().interactable = false;